MLOB home-café is a cafe, located at Aleah Road, Siem Reap, Cambodia. They can be contacted via phone at +855 12 944 990 for more detailed information.

  • Nicolahood3
    15 March 2017

    We were attracted by the beautiful setting at first. Then we met the owner. What a fantastic man - so welcoming and thankful we had come to his restaurant. He works with villagers during the day and at night he is making his dream to have a restaurant a reality. He is giving opportunities to the villagers - one girl had been working picking sweet potatoes for 12 hours a day in the hot sun and earning $1 per day! Aside from the warmth and heart behind this restaurant, the food was sublime!! Beautiful simple Khmer food bursting with flavour. The prices were so low it was funny - but that made it easier to leave a big tip to help this restaurant grow and give more underprivileged people a chance to make something more of life. One of the best finds on this trip!
